web-dev-qa-db-ja.com

デスクトップ環境を取り除き、ウィンドウマネージャーのみを使用する方法

私はすべての作業にxtermを使用しています。 GNOMEのようなデスクトップ環境が提供しなければならない機能はあまり役に立たないことに気づきました。これで、GNOMEとKDEを完全に削除して、実行レベル5(X11)でのみウィンドウマネージャーを使用してビデオを再生したり、ブラウザーを使用したり、場合によってはNautilusなどのファイルマネージャーを使用したりできます。どうすればできますか?それは良い考えですか?どのウィンドウマネージャを提案しますか?

これまでに行ったこと:インストール済み Window Maker 。再起動すると、ログイン時にGNOME、KDE、Window Makerの選択肢がもう1つ提示されました。私はWindow Makerを選びました。パネル、通知領域、デスクトップアイコンなどの通常のデスクトップ機能なしで、複数のワークスペース、カスタマイズ可能なキーボードショートカットを提供します。

しかし、Nautilusを起動するたびに、デスクトップの背景がGNOMEで設定したものに変わり、すべてのデスクトップアイコンがGNOMEと同じように復元されますが、Window Makerのキーボードショートカットは引き続き機能します。しかし、GNOMEの背景とデスクトップのアイコンを削除するには、ログアウトして再度ログインする必要があります。

Nautilusを起動してもGNOMEの背景が表示されないようにするにはどうすればよいですか?他のファイルマネージャを使用する必要がありますか?

更新

私は準拠し、dwmをインストールしました。全然難しくなかった。ただし、ログイン画面のメニューにdwmを表示するには、次の手順を実行する必要がありました。

$ cd /usr/share/xsessions/  
$ vim dwm.desktop  

の中に dwm.desktop 私が書いた:

[Desktop Entry]
Encoding=UTF-8
Name=dwm
Comment=To start dwm session
Exec=/usr/local/bin/dwm
Type=Application

今回ログインすると、メニューにdwmが表示されました。

更新

ノーチラスの問題は次の手順で解決しました。

$ gconftool-2 --recursive-list "/apps" |less

ここでnautilusを検索しました。それは私に与えました

 /apps/nautilus:
  /apps/nautilus/preferences:
   show_icon_text = local_only
   start_with_sidebar = true
   click_policy = double
   background_color = #ffffff
   start_with_toolbar = true
   start_with_location_bar = true
   mouse_back_button = 8
   thumbnail_limit = 10485760
   directory_limit = -1
   ...

その後はキーを設定するだけの簡単なことでした

$ gconftool-2 --get "/apps/nautilus/preferences/show_desktop"
$ true
$ gconftool-2 --set "/apps/nautilus/preferences/show_desktop" --type bool false
$ gconftool-2 --get "/apps/nautilus/preferences/exit_with_last_window
$ false
$ gconftool-2 --set "/apps/nautilus/preferences/exit_with_last_window" --type bool true
$ gconftool-2 --get "/apps/nautilus/preferences/media_automount_open
$ true
$ gconftool-2 --set "/apps/nautilus/preferences/media_automount_open" --type bool false

役立つリンク

16
Andrew-Dufresne

同様の質問 を1回尋ねました。デスクトップ環境に付属するその他のツールや機能を無視している場合は、間違いなく良い考えです。

解決策は、デスクトップ環境(または使用しないもの)をインストールする必要がなく、選択したウィンドウマネージャーをインストールするだけです。私は(また) 別の質問 軽量ウィンドウマネージャについて尋ねました。まとめは、多くのエフェクトが必要な場合は Compiz 、そうでない場合は dwm のような軽量なものを選択します。

Nautilusに関して、本当にそれが必要ですか、それともいくつかの機能が必要ですか?そうでない場合は、おそらく Thunar に切り替える必要があります。

13
phunehehe

Nautilusを起動してもGNOMEの背景が表示されないようにするにはどうすればよいですか?

これが発生する理由は、NautilusがGnomeのファイルマネージャであるだけでなく、Gnomeのデスクトップの描画も担当しているためです。したがって、nautilusを起動すると、それが責任の1つと見なされるため、デスクトップがレンダリングされます。

この動作を無効にするには、オプション--no-desktopを使用して呼び出すか、gconfキー/apps/nautilus/preferences/show_desktopをfalseに設定します。

15
sepp2k

別のランレベルに切り替えるだけの方が簡単ではないですか? (GUIなしのランレベル)

0
fromnaboo